Enlever saut de ligne automatique avec div

Résolu/Fermé
hbhh - 14 mars 2008 à 14:28
 Ibro - 24 févr. 2014 à 00:32
Bonjour,

Au pied de page de mon site je voudrais mettre un numéro de tèl , et une adresse e-mail avec un lien.
Comme ceci:
Tèl: 00.00.00.00.00 - adresse@mail.com
(les 2 ALIGNES et séparés d'un tiret.)
Mais je ne veux pas de soulignement (du lien) et je veux mettre une certaine couleur.
donc j'ai fait un <div id="mail"> dans mon code html
mon css:
#mail a{
text-decoration:none;
color:grey;}

Le problème c'est qu'avec le div apparemment il y a un saut de ligne automatique!
Comment je peux faire pour l'enlever???


Merci d'avance...

5 réponses

truthlesslife
13 avril 2008 à 23:57
Salut,

Même si ça fait un mois que la question à été posée, la réponse servira pour les suivants...
Pour annuler le passage automatique à la ligne d'une balise on peut lui ajouter dans le style :

display: inline;

@++
Ludo
48
Jean-Francois
22 avril 2009 à 23:40
En effet merci.
0
Attention, si on met la propriété display : inline; on ne peut pas attribuer de taille width et height au bloc DIV.
0
ca marche pas...toujours pas, je deviens fou...
0
Merci
0
Un display: inline-block; est préférable
0
<?PHP
$sql = mysql_query("SELECT * FROM users WHERE rank >= '3' && categorie = 'F.P.S' LIMIT 5");
while($s = mysql_fetch_array($sql)) {
echo '<div class="bloc" style="width: 125px; height: 125px;"><a href="./users.php?id='.$s['id'].'"><img src="'.$s['avatar'].'" style="width: 100px; height: 100px; padding-top: 5px;"/><br/>'.$s['username'].'</a></div>';

}?>

J'ai fait ça, pour affichez les utilisateurs du rank 3 ou supérieur et de la catégorie= F.P.S dans un bloc. Chaque bloc représente un membre. Mais il s'affiche en colonne. Cela affiche, un bloc avec l'utilisateur dedans, puis retourne à la ligne et met un nouveau bloc, nouveau membre ... J'aimerais ne pas retourné à la ligne. Mais cela vas annulé width et height. Comment faire ? :-)
3
WAHOU !!! Sa fait plusieurs heures que je cherchais !!!

MERCI !!!!!
0
Mes les blocs dans un div conteneur .
2 mets tous les blocs en float.
3 Puis place ce conteneur en absolute parraport a la page.
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
goldo Messages postés 72 Date d'inscription mercredi 23 juin 2004 Statut Membre Dernière intervention 28 juin 2010 8
14 mars 2008 à 14:43
Quelles sont les caractéristiques de ton div (largeur, hauteur) ?

Car si il fait un saut de ligne c'est que ton div est trés petit et ne peut pas contenir en une ligne ces infos.
-3